Output 59742622de13eb01ae163f4e172458ab5e989d075b9106a5185d0d64521ec369:0

value
19500000
script pubkey
OP_0 OP_PUSHBYTES_20 e26782fa97450069481f2a90118c13509b2d043b
address
bc1qufnc975hg5qxjjql92gprrqn2zdj6ppmjj4egr
transaction
59742622de13eb01ae163f4e172458ab5e989d075b9106a5185d0d64521ec369